The Benefits of Going Solar

Solar energy is becoming increasingly central to American homes. The integration of solar energy into the electric grid has surged, with approximately four million U.S. homes now powered by solar. The benefits of residential solar include the declining cost of solar panels, bolstered by the federal residential solar tax credit, which allows homeowners to deduct 30% of solar system costs from their federal income taxes—a potential average saving of $6,000. Eligibility for this credit requires owning the solar panels, having taxable income, and installing the system at one's prone or secondary residence. For instance, if a homeowner with a $15,000 tax liability utilizes the solar tax credit, their owed amount could be reduced to $9,000.


This federal tax credit benefits homeowners with high electricity bills and substantial tax liabilities who value sustainable energy solutions.


Leasing and power purchase agreements allow homeowners to embrace solar without the upfront financial burden, maintaining low monthly energy bills without acquiring new debt.

Reducing Monthly Utility Bills

Adopting solar can significantly decrease monthly utility expenses. With rising utility rates, solar remains a cost-effective alternative. The savings depend on the amount of electricity used, the size of the solar system, and its output capacity.


Reliability in Power Outages

Solar power systems, especially those paired with battery storage, can provide electricity during power outages, ensuring energy independence from the grid. As battery technology progresses and financial incentives for energy storage become more prevalent, more households are finding it viable to invest in solar batteries.


Enhancing Property Value

Investing in solar can increase a property. The Berkeley National Laboratory shows that homes with solar systems often sell at a premium, comparable to homes with major upgrades like a renovated kitchen or a finished basement.


Environmental Benefits

Solar power offers significant environmental benefits over fossil fuels. It operates without emitting greenhouse gases and thus helps mitigate climate change.
